Liberty Energy Inc. stock has shown a 84% rise over 5 years, below market average. Recent 2.5% increase prompts a closer look at fundamentals. Strong long-term performance contrasts with recent pullback of 9.3%.
Read MoreDid you find this insightful?
Bad
Just Okay
Amazing